About the project
Defence Maintenance Contract - Maintenance services provided by Joint Logistics Command play a significant role in supporting Australian Defence Force units preparing for and returning from operations and exercises. Our services will help ensure the availability and safe working order of Defence assets. The contract includes repair and maintenance of some of Australia's newest and most advanced equipment including surveillance systems, marine craft, light armoured vehicles, and protected mobility vehicles. It also includes operation of a 24/7 nationwide vehicle and equipment recovery service.
